ABC GOES COUNTRY WITH PROGRAMMING AND APPEARANCES LEADING UP TO THE "THE 43rd ANNUAL CMA AWARDS"

ABC, the official broadcast home of "Country Music's Biggest Night,�" is getting the festivities started early with programming celebrating the best of Country Music leading up to the big gala, "The 43rd Annual CMA Awards." The show will be broadcast live from the Sommet Center in Nashville, WEDNESDAY, NOVEMBER 11 (8:00-11:00 p.m., ET) on the ABC Television Network.

From Primetime to Daytime, ABC is going Country! Highlights include:

Tuesday, October 27 (9:00-10:01 p.m., ET) � "Dancing with the Stars Results Show" � It's Country Music night at "Dancing" when Taylor Swift, who sold more records in 2008 than any artist in the world, makes a very special appearance on the release date of the Platinum Edition of her "Fearless" album to premiere a brand-new single, "Jump, Then Fall," as well as perform her worldwide chart-topping hit, "Love Story." Taylor, who at 19 is the youngest artist in history to be nominated for the Country Music Association's prestigious Entertainer of the Year Award, is currently nominated for four Country Music Association Awards and 6 American Music Awards.

Tuesday, November 3 (7:00-9:00 a.m., ET) � "Good Morning America" � CMA Awards co-host and five-time CMA Award winner and the first country music artist in history to achieve 10 No.-1 singles from their first two albums, Carrie Underwood will be stopping in New York to make an appearance on "Good Morning America." Her highly anticipated new album, "Play On," featuring the current smash single, "Cowboy Casanova," is being released on November 3.

Sunday, November 8 (8:00-9:00 p.m., ET) � "Extreme Makeover: Home Edition" � Country Music sensation Kellie Pickler joins the "Extreme Makeover: Home Edition" team in Beavercreek, Ohio, to tell James Terpenning, a wheelchair sports champion and mentor to disabled Iraqi War veterans, that he and his family will have their home rebuilt in seven days. Kellie will be the celebrity volunteer for this build and will perform her new song at the family's reveal.

Tuesday, November 10 (10:01-11:00 p.m., ET) � "In the Spotlight with Robin Roberts: Bright Lights. Big Stars. All Access Nashville." � ABC News' Robin Roberts sits down wish some of Country Music's hottest stars in this hour-long special. In addition to interviews with legendary artists Loretta Lynn, Vince Gill and Rosanne Cash, Carrie Underwood takes Roberts back to her hometown in Oklahoma where Underwood surprises her former high-school with a very big, musical surprise; Tim McGraw takes Roberts horseback riding on his family farm and opens up about his challenging childhood; and Robin Roberts joins Martina McBride and her family in their Nashville home and also spends time with the country superstar at Blackbird Studios.

Tuesday, November 10 (7:00-9:00 a.m., ET) � "Good Morning America" � Returning CMA co-hosts Brad Paisley and Carrie Underwood will perform live outside the Sommet Center in Nashville. This concert is free and open to the public.

Tuesday, November 10 � ABCNEWS.com � ABCNEWS.com will feature a special section for "In the Spotlight with Robin Roberts: Bright Lights. Big Stars. All Access Nashville." The section will feature extended interviews with Carrie Underwood, Tim McGraw and Martina McBride, as well as additional photos and music. Viewers will be able to log onto ABCNEWS.com and vote for their favorite country song immediately following the special on Tuesday evening. America's favorite country song will be revealed live on "Good Morning America" the following morning.

Country Music's superstars and the industry's elite will gather to recognize and celebrate the best and brightest performers, songwriters, record producers and music video directors on "The 43rd Annual CMA Awards." Some of the performers will include Brad Paisley and Carrie Underwood, who are hosting the gala for the second time, Kenny Chesney and Dave Matthews, Jason Aldean, Brooks & Dunn, Billy Currington, Vince Gill and Daughtry, Lady Antebellum, Miranda Lambert, Reba McEntire, Tim McGraw, Brad Paisley, Darius Rucker, George Strait, Sugarland, Taylor Swift, Keith Urban and Zac Brown Band. Additional artists and presenters will be added to the lineup and announced soon.

"The 43rd Annual CMA Awards" is a production of the Country Music Association. Robert Deaton is the executive producer. Paul Miller is the director. David Wild is the writer. The special will be shot in high definition and broadcast in 720 Progressive (720P), ABC's selected HDTV format, with 5.1 channel surround sound.
